Sleep Mode

Setting A Sleep Period
It is possible to programme iBLIK to turn
off after a pre-defined period of time.
To do so, select the 'System setup'
option from the Main Menu, then select
'Time setup', then 'Sleep'.

iBLIK will now automatically put itself into
standby mode after the time has
elapsed.

System Setup

Time Setup
The time can be set in one of two ways,
either manually via the 'Time setup' option
on the in the System Menu, or
alternatively simply press the MODE key
until iBLIK DAB+ enters DAB Mode. In
DAB mode, iBLIK will automatically set the
correct time and date from the DAB
transmitter. iBLIK will remember its time
setting even when in standby mode, and
will only lose the time/date when power is
removed.
Under the 'Time Setup' menu, you can
also switch between 12 an 24 hour clock
formats.
Lastly, the 'Auto Update' option in the
'Time Setup' menu allows you to select
whether or not the time should be
synchronised with the DAB broadcaster
clock. If 'No Update' is selected, then the
clock remains as manually set.
Info

Software Version

You may be asked for the current
software version when dealing with a
technical support issue.
The software version can be found under
the 'Info' heading, located in the 'Main
Menu'.

Factory Reset

In the unlikely event that iBLIK DAB+
should 'crash', 'freeze' or start behaving in
a strange way, it is possible to perform a
full software reset. This operation will
completely reset iBLIK's memory. This will
effectively return iBLIK to its default
factory settings.
